Rationale:
In support to the reading assessment tools (EGRA AND PHIL-IRI), the
school made use of all the resources and donations they could possibly get in order
to build and create PROJECT R.E.A.D (Reading Endeavors Across Disciplines).
This project tends to provide interactive remediation in their reading skills with a
touch of learning across other subjects. Moreover, the project somehow helps
young learners learn better and faster in their numeracy and literacy while having
fun with the physical fun activities. This is designed with colorful murals of numbers,
letters, colors, shapes where kids can move, jump, spell, do basic math operations,
and color-shape identification.
Objectives:
The objectives of the program states as follows:
➢ to serve as an interactive remediation to students in their literacy and
numeracy skills
➢ to provide fun physical activities while improving students’ academic skills
